French offers a complete program of language, application of language to other fields, literature and culture that prepares students for careers in many fields. Student options in French include a major, joint majors and a minor. Majors are prepared to teach and to undertake graduate studies and research in the language and/or to use the language in linked careers such as business. The joint majors combine French with Spanish (Romance Languages) and Romance Languages with International Studies. In cooperation with the School of Education, the program offers courses that lead to primary and secondary teaching certification in French.
Students in the major reach an advanced level of proficiency in their listening, speaking, reading and writing skills. They receive an in-depth vision of French culture from the beginning to contemporary French or Francophone culture in France, Africa, Asia and the Americas.
The program incorporates and highly recommends French studies in a French-speaking country. The program collaborates with universities and institutions in French-speaking countries. Supporting studies in history, art history and linguistics as well as in other languages and literature are also advisable. |
